Quote:
Originally Posted by yonah View Post
I have no evidence between 2007 (except for my HS diploma in 07) to 2008...
I do have an driver's license that expired in 08, but that's it. I began banking in 09...
Since you were in school in the first quarter, of the year 07, you can get the school transcripsts, your diploma's date should count for the second quarter and you will need something for the third quarter and something for the fourth quarter

January, February, March = first quarter
April, May, June = second quarter
July, August, September = third quarter
October, November, December = fourth quarter

You can show Doctor visits, drug test, vaccination record, rent receipt, orientation, church involment, volunteer history, job, bills you payed in person, tickets with name and dates, western union, season pass to an amusement park might be trackable an printed for the dates you showed, anything that shows your name with date of your presence in this country, think, think, think....

Quote:
Originally Posted by Abrahmm View Post
Should we send all the info and proof we can find or should we just send the proof that answers the main 7 questions?
One of my friends said to send everything I can find from school awards to College receipts & to include an index with everything numbered so that ICE can identify where everything is with ease. What do you guys think?

Proof from June 15 2007 to June 15 2012

Meaning one or two things for each quarter in chronological order for all five years and all copies should be printed on letter size. Label your name and date on each paper of evidence.

January, February, March = first quarter
April, May, June = second quarter
July, August, September = third quarter
October, November, December = fourth quarter

The rest of the 6 questions are more specific.

If you have school ID's from elementary through high school and college, try to put them all together in one color copy and put these next to your identity papers.
